SA 669. Ms. DUCKWORTH submitted an amendment intended to be proposed
by her to the bill H.R. 2810, to authorize appropriations for fiscal
year 2018 for military activities of the Department of Defense, for
military construction, and for defense activities of the Department of
Energy, to prescribe military personnel strengths for such fiscal year,
and for other purposes; which was ordered to lie on the table; as
follows:
At the end of subtitle C of title VII, add the following:
SEC. ___. IMPLEMENTATION OF GAO RECOMMENDATIONS TO IMPROVE
MEDICAL FACILITIES OF THE DEPARTMENT OF DEFENSE
AND THE DEPARTMENT OF VETERANS AFFAIRS.
(a) In General.--Not later than 180 days after the date of
the enactment of this Act, the Secretary of Defense and the
Secretary of Veterans Affairs shall develop and submit to
Congress a comprehensive and detailed strategic
implementation plan to fully implement all 14 open
recommendations, as of such date of enactment, produced by
the Government Accountability Office in relation to its
report entitled ``VA and DOD Need to Address Ongoing
Difficulties and Better Prepare for Future Integrations''
that was published on February 29, 2016.
(b) Public Availability.--The Secretary of Defense and the
Secretary of Veterans Affairs shall each publish the
strategic implementation plan developed under subsection (a)
on the public Internet website of the Department of Defense
and the Department of Veterans Affairs, respectively.
(c) Update.--Not later than 180 days after publication of
the strategic implementation plan under subsection (b), the
Secretary of Defense and the Secretary of Veterans Affairs
shall develop and submit to Congress a comprehensive and
detailed status update report on the progress made in fully
implementing all open recommendations described in subsection
(a).
